This was a non slip application on a high traffic, stadium concession area. The constant wet surface caused by water, sodas, alcoholic beverages, as well as grease created a slip surface and the employees had difficulty maintaining solid footing. The first part of the anti slip equation for tiles is what is used to adhere to the surface. National Sealing’s answer is our coating process. This is a very durable, multi-component coating that is applied to the surface. With ceramic, quarry, porcelain tiles which can have significant grout lines, this coating process serves a dual role; preserving the surface of the tile while also preserving the grout. This coating process forms a clear, hard barrier to make the surface easy to maintain as well as preserving the integrity of the tile.
Once the coating has been applied to the surface, we add our anti slip aggregate. In the past we used grip additives that were made of plastics. We found our coating was out lasting the grip additive. Currently we have manufactured for National Sealing Co. small glass beads to take the place of the plastic media. We have found the glass beads to be much more durable, they become imbedded leaving the surface easier to clean, and the finish is of a higher quality.
Our anti slip produces a very durable, long lasting and very effective approach to slippery surfaces.
